Function module to modify the user roles & profiles
Hi All,
I am working on user maintenance and i need a function module to modify the user roles & profiles.
Thanks in Advance.
Phani.
i used the below fms
BAPI_USER_ACTGROUPS_ASSIGN for assigning the roles.
delete the profiles of the user qnd assign the profiles to the user:
BAPI_USER_PROFILES_DELETE
BAPI_USER_PROFILES_ASSIGN
i used the above FMs for my requirement.

ABAP program/Function module to assign the roles in SU01
Hi,
Is there any ABAP program/function module to assign the roles in SU01. And program/function module which does all teh SU01 related activities.
Thanks and Regards,
RashmiHello,
Check the function modules that start with BAPI_USER*
To assign roles :
BAPI_USER_ACTGROUPS_ASSIGN
To assign profiles :
BAPI_USER_PROFILES_ASSIGN
To change user's metadata (name, settings, ... other SU01 functions) :
BAPI_USER_CHANGE

Trying to understand "User/Role/Profile Synchronization" and Batch Analysis
Hello,
Im trying to understand what exactly and from which tables these jobs are copying to which tables in CC. I have a understanding that these jobs are moving also deleted roles from backend. This is causing unnecessary delay to long lasting job.
I would appreasite if some one could explain the logic behind these jobs. What the fullsync and incremental is reading ? What kind of changes are causing a role/user/profile to be included to the full and incremental jobs?
How the incremental analysis logic is built ?
br JanneJanne,
In my current implementation we are going for an offline risk analysis due to the heteregoneus system landscape of our client (several SAP and non SAP systems and several SAP systems under 4.6C). Eventhough within our approach we don't perfrom the backend synchronization (we use CC data extractor to pull data from backend into CC) hope the following info could hel you:
The tables such jobs you mention access to, are all the SAP backend system tables related with users, roles, profiles, action and permissions. If you check the data mapping appendix of the "user and configuration guide for 5.2" you will see all the data that CC retrieves. For instance, in order to extract user info (UserID, FName, LName, Email, Phone, Email, Department) tables USR21, USR02, ADRP, ADR6 and ADCP must be accessed.
In terms of CC tables:
VIRSA_CC_SYSUSR >> UserIDs and Systems ID relationship
VIRSA_CC_GENOBJ >> User, Role and Profile master data
VIRSA_CC_GENACT >> User-action, role-action and profile-action data
VIRSA_CC_GENPRM >> User-permission, role-permission and profile-permission
VIRSA_CC_SAPOBJ >> Action-permission
VIRSA_CC_OBJTEXT >> Objects descripcions (ACT, PRM, FLD, VAL, ORG)

Hi abap gurus,
I have an inbound idoc coming form a wms system .The IDOC is for goods recieved . how can I read the idoc to update the inbound delivery data in the sap system ? Is there any function module to read the data from teh inbound idoc ?Hi Gaurab,
Creating a Function Module (Direct Inbound Processing)
This step describes how to create a function module which is identified by the IDoc Interface using a new process code and called from ALE (field TBD52-FUNCNAME). Direct inbound processing using a function module (not using a workflow) always includes the ALE layer. This setting (processing with function module and ALE layer) is identified by the value 6 in the field TEDE2-EDIVRS, which is read by the function module IDOC_START_INBOUND. IDOC_START_INBOUND then calls ALE.
Prerequisites
You must have completed the required steps in Defining and Using a Basic Type .
Procedure
Choose Tools ® ABAP Workbench ® Development ® Function Builder, and create a new function module.
Create the segments as global data in your function group. The function module should copy the application data from the segments into the corresponding application tables and modify the IDoc status accordingly. If an error occurs, the function module must set the corresponding workflow parameters for exception handling.
Activate the function module: From the initial screen of the Function Builder select .
In the example, create the function module IDOC_INPUT_TESTER with a global interface. The function module is called when an IDoc of type TESTER01 is received for inbound processing. You will assign an application object ("standard order") to this IDoc type and therefore maintain tables from SD. To do this, call transaction VA01 using the command CALL TRANSACTION. Please note that the intention here is not to simulate a realistic standard order, but only to illustrate how data reaches application tables from an IDoc table via segment structures (form routine READ_IDOC_TESTER) and how the function module triggers an event for exception handling (by returning suitable return variables to the ALE layer in the FORM routine RETURN_VARIABLES_FILL).
A comprehensive example of the code for an inbound function module is provided in the ALE documentation in the SAP Library under Example Program to Generate an IDoc. This function module, for example, also checks whether the logical message is correct and calls a (fictitious) second function module which first writes the application data and then returns the number of the generated document. In addition, status 53 is only set if the application document was posted correctly.
